吞吐量测试方法
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
JPerf2.0测试方法
JPerf2.0工具简介
Jperf是将iperf命令行图形化的JA V A程序;
使用JPerf程序能简化了复杂命令行参数的构造,而且它还保存测试结果,同时实时图形化显示结果。
JPerf2.0运行环境
操作系统:Java运行环境
网络要求:Jperf可以在任何IP 网络上运行,包括本地以太网,因特网接入连接和Wi-Fi 网络。
JPerf2.0页面如下图:
JPerf2.0具体介绍
1)Iperf命令行(无法直接输入,当输入Server address后自动生成)
2)服务端设置
监听端口:5001
3)客户端设置
TV IP地址:192.168.1.102 ,端口:5001 ,并发流:1个
4)应用层设置
1、兼容旧版本(当server端和client端版本不一样时使用)
2、设置测试模式:测试300s吞吐量,取平均值
3、同时进行双向传输测试
4、单独进行双向传输测试,先测c到s的带宽
5、指定需要传输的文件
6、显示tcp最大mtu值
5)传输层设置
1、TCP协议
设置缓冲区大小
指定TCP窗口大小
设定TCP数据包的最大mtu值
设定TCP不延时
2、UDP协议
设置UDP最大带宽
设置UDP缓冲区
UDP包封装大小:默认1470 byte
6)IP层设置
1、指定ttl值
2、服务类型(Type of Service, ToS),大小范围从0x10 (最小延迟) 到0x2 (最少费
用)
在使用802.11e来控制服务质量的WLAN中,ToS是映射在Wi‐Fi多媒体(WMM)存
取范畴的。
测试步骤如下:
1、搭建测试环境
2、Jperf工具设置
双击打开,需要设置项
TV连上wifi后,在客户端输入IP地址
测试时间长度设置
输出单位设置
TCP窗口大小设置
3、运行iperf文件
将iperf.dat文件拷入U盘中,接到TV source下Ctrl+z /*终止当前任务,让程序在后台运行*/ mount -o remount rw /usb/sda/ /*赋予读写权利*/ cd ../../usb/sda/ /*进入iperf所在目录*/
./iperf.dat –s /*运行iperf文件*/
运行Jperf
4、测试结果